I am planning to begin monthly Caddyinfo.com contests. Each contest will have specific rules stated in the invitation post. The purpose of the contests is to have fun, to build community by hearing more about people especially how people got or use their Cadillacs, and in some cases to showcase vendors who offer or support Cadillac products. The first contest would be this month.

The contest ideas I have in mind are: best story related to buying / owning /enjoying your Cadillac, best Cadillac photo of the month, most helpful post of the month, Cadillac trivia (with drawings from the correct answers). The contests will notionally be monthly, although an individual contest might last for only a few days, or a week.

Prizes for non-supporting members will be Supporting Membership for 6 months duration.

Prizes for Supporting Members will be announced, usually either Cash, Supporting Vendor donated Cadillac related items, or Cadillac related prizes such as hats, or gift certificates, etc. The individual invitation post will detail the prize planned for that month.

Individuals could only win say once a quarter. They could still play / participate, but the prize would go to 2nd place if they won for example.

I am open to other ideas of course. We may try judging by polls some months, or nominations by PM to me, in the case of trivia answers or best posts votes, or having my Wife choose if objectivity is key, or taste, otherwise I would select a winner based on the contest criteria.
